Position Summary

The Demand Planning Analyst is responsible for analyzing historical sales, trends, promotions, seasonality, and market signals to develop accurate demand forecasts. This role supports the company’s Sales, Inventory & Operations Planning (SIOP) process and contributes to achieving service level targets, reducing excess inventory, and improving inventory turns across a complex, multi-echelon supply chain. The ideal candidate is analytical, detail-oriented, and adept at translating data into actionable inventory and procurement strategies.

Responsibilities
  • Analyze historical sales, customer demand, promotional activity, and external trends to build item-level forecasts across national and regional branch networks.
  • Maintain and continuously improve forecast accuracy metrics (e.g., MAPE, bias) by SKU, category, and region.
  • Collaborate with Inventory Planning, Procurement, and Category Management to align forecasts with stocking strategies and vendor MOQs.
  • Support monthly SIOP meetings with forecast variance reporting, product lifecycle updates, and insights on forecast drivers.
  • Leverage planning tools and BI platforms (e.g., DRP, Excel, SQL, Power BI) to visualize trends and track forecast performance.
  • Incorporate input from Sales and Category teams on upcoming promotions, new product introductions (NPIs), and regional shifts in demand.
  • Flag exceptions such as chronic under-forecasting, overstock risk, and demand anomalies; recommend corrective actions.
  • Partner with IT and Analytics to refine demand models and enhance system-generated forecasts using machine learning or historical regression techniques.
  • Support inventory conversion planning for product transitions, branch rollouts, and network optimization initiatives.
Qualifications
  • Bachelor’s degree in Supply Chain, Business Analytics, Finance, or related field; APICS/IBF certification is a plus
  • 2+ years of experience in demand planning, forecasting, or inventory analytics within distribution or retail
  • Strong analytical skills with proficiency in Excel (pivot tables, formulas), SQL, and data visualization tools (Power BI or Tableau)
  • Experience with demand planning or ERP systems such as PTC Servigistics, JD Edwards, SAP, or similar
  • Knowledge of SIOP or IBP process preferred
  • Ability to communicate insights clearly and collaborate across cross-functional teams
  • Detail-oriented with a continuous improvement mindset
Preferred Skills
  • Experience with aftermarket auto parts, high-SKU environments, or regional demand segmentation
  • Understanding of lead time variability, vendor constraints, and their impact on inventory positioning
  • Ability to manage large datasets and draw insights from complex supply chain scenarios
